Taylor Cole wins NWL Pitcher of the Week
The right-hander out of Las Vegas, NV was unhittable in his last start against the Yakima Bears as Cole threw 95 pitches over 7 2/3 innings of work and did not give up a hit while striking out six.
"Sure I was a bit disappointed coming out of the game with a no-hitter, but that's just my competitive nature", said Cole on Team1410 Sports Radio this past Monday.
"I respect the decision to bring me out of the game and understand why it was done. It was a team win against the Bears and I was happy to simply see us put together a victory with the post-season on the line".
This is the first Pitcher of the Week Award for Cole who finished the Northwest League regular season with a perfect 6-0 record and a NWL leading 0.81ERA through his 11 starts in 2012.
This marks the 4th award of the summer for a Canadians pitcher as RHP Javier Avendano was named top arm three times between June 25th and September 3rd.
